About this earthquake

On July 13, 2026 at 06:14 UTC, a magnitude M3.0 earthquake occurred near Humboldt County, California (United States). The hypocenter lay relatively close to the surface at around 20 km, increasing how strongly it was felt. Events of this size typically go unnoticed.

The event was recorded by USGS. United States: 174 earthquakes were recorded in the past 24 hours, the strongest reaching M5.2.

Why depth matters

Shallow quakes release energy near the surface — shaking is felt more strongly and damage potential is higher.
